From 38a3c879a589d8f73d7912e8fc2f64d7b8c667c0 Mon Sep 17 00:00:00 2001 From: Bharat Kunwar Date: Fri, 5 Jun 2020 15:23:33 +0000 Subject: [PATCH] Revert "Change the order of resource creation" This reverts commit 18be349d4a275aadcb3df11f03d06b0dd2c4c633. It leads to a circular dependency error in Stein therefore incompatible. Error waiting for openstack_containerinfra_cluster_v1 14807cc0-52e6-4c72-9128-aa61ddd4ba6d to become ready: openstack_containerinfra_cluster_v1 is in an error state: ERROR: CircularDependencyException: : resources.kube_masters.resources.0: : Circular Dependency Found: {NoneResource "etcd_volume_attach": {Server "kube-master"}, Server "kube-master": {MultipartMime "kube_master_init"}, NoneResource "docker_volume_attach": {Server "kube-master"}, TemplateResource "api_address_switch": {NoneResource "kube_master_floating"}, MultipartMime "kube_master_init": {SoftwareConfig "write_heat_params"}, SoftwareConfig "write_heat_params": {NoneResource "kube_master_floating", TemplateResource "api_address_switch"}, NoneResource "kube_master_floating": {Server "kube-master"}} Change-Id: I00f36aa03352bff19ebecac9fa9d078f33abd39e --- magnum/drivers/k8s_fedora_atomic_v1/templates/kubemaster.yaml | 1 - magnum/drivers/k8s_fedora_atomic_v1/templates/kubeminion.yaml | 1 - 2 files changed, 2 deletions(-) diff --git a/magnum/drivers/k8s_fedora_atomic_v1/templates/kubemaster.yaml b/magnum/drivers/k8s_fedora_atomic_v1/templates/kubemaster.yaml index dd16ed30ba..b6b98d7dc6 100644 --- a/magnum/drivers/k8s_fedora_atomic_v1/templates/kubemaster.yaml +++ b/magnum/drivers/k8s_fedora_atomic_v1/templates/kubemaster.yaml @@ -725,7 +725,6 @@ resources: properties: floating_network: {get_param: external_network} port_id: {get_resource: kube_master_eth0} - depends_on: kube-master api_pool_member: type: Magnum::Optional::Neutron::LBaaS::PoolMember diff --git a/magnum/drivers/k8s_fedora_atomic_v1/templates/kubeminion.yaml b/magnum/drivers/k8s_fedora_atomic_v1/templates/kubeminion.yaml index 90ca58bf2f..928d79ecb2 100644 --- a/magnum/drivers/k8s_fedora_atomic_v1/templates/kubeminion.yaml +++ b/magnum/drivers/k8s_fedora_atomic_v1/templates/kubeminion.yaml @@ -509,7 +509,6 @@ resources: properties: floating_network: {get_param: external_network} port_id: {get_resource: kube_minion_eth0} - depends_on: kube-minion ###################################################################### #